Police are searching for a suspect accused of raping a 5-year-old girl inside a Staten Island home last week.
Dominique Giles, 30, allegedly sexually assaulted the child, who was known to him, on Jan. 22 inside a residence near Richmond Terrace and Sharpe Avenue in Port Richmond around 5:38 a.m., according to authorities.
The suspect then fled the home on foot, according to police.
The young girl was taken to Richmond University Medical Center for an evaluation after the disturbing incident.
Authorities mentioned that this is not Giles’ first offense.
In April, he was arrested for allegedly assaulting his girlfriend by choking and pummeling her while breaking her phone in the Brighton Heights neighborhood of Staten Island.
He faced charges of felony criminal mischief of property and assault, as per the police.

The NYPD has released a mug shot of the suspect in hopes of apprehending him.
He was last seen wearing a black hooded jacket, as per police.
